Jim Cunningham – 2015 Parliamentary Question to the Department for Education

The below Parliamentary question was asked by Jim Cunningham on 2015-11-03.

To ask the Secretary of State for Education, what estimate her Department has made of the amount spent on advertising campaigns aimed at teacher recruitment in each of the last five years; and if she will make a statement.

Nick Gibb

The estimated amount spent on advertising campaigns aimed at teacher recruitment in each of the last five years is:

2010-11

2011-12

2012-13

2013-14

2014-15

Total spend

£4,210,000

£4,630,000

£6,020,000

£1,800,000

£4,770,000

These estimates include advertising campaign costs, such as production and purchased media space in TV, newspapers, online and social media.
